Cooler Performance Guidelines

  • To achieve maximum performance in your new cooler you must use it properly. Use plenty of ice and pre-chill the cooler and its contents before placing them in the cooler.
  • Put the ice in the cooler. Remember, cold air travels down, so if you want your beverages well chilled, load cans and bottles first, then cover with ice.
  • Choose cube or block ice. Use cube ice to quickly cool food and drinks, block ice to keep it cold longer.
  • More ice is better. We recommend filling your cooler with as much ice as possible. We suggest an ice-to-contents ratio of 2:1. Fill void space.
  • Keep cooler out of the sun. Ice lasts up to twice as long when the cooler is in the shade.
  • Close lid quickly after opening. Do not leave the lid open longer than necessary.
  • Don’t drain the cold water. Recently melted ice keeps food and drinks cold. Melted ice water preserves ice better than empty air space.
  • Fully filled with ice cubes, the ice retention time can reach more than 5 days (based on 25°C room temperature). It’s for reference only, the actual ice retention time depends on the actual situation.
  • Due to its durable materials, the soft cooler may be rigid when first put into action, zippering will become easier as the materials relax with use. Or apply the lubricant (silicone grease) to the zipper to facilitate pulling.
  • Pro Tip: use rock salt If you are looking to super-chill your beverages, here is a pro tip that can make the difference: Rock Salt. This will produce some of the coldest drinks you have ever had, and in a relatively short period of time. Here is how to do it:

  1. Properly fill your cooler with beer and plenty of ice;
  2. Generously sprinkle rock salt on top of ice and close the lid;
  3. Wait 30 minutes, then enjoy frigid awesomeness.

Note Avoid dry ice. Dry ice is the solid form of Carbon Dioxide and its -109°F temperature makes it a very attractive cooling alternative, but we still recommend against it and here is why. As dry ice warms up, it becomes CO2 gas instead of melting. The cooler is so airtight that they will inflate with this CO2 gas until they expand, which threatens the integrity of your cooler.

Cleaning and Storage

Cleaning
  • Clean the inside and outside. Clean the inside with a solution of mild soap and warm water, especially before first use.
  • Always clean after use, especially if used in salt water environment.
  • To remove tough stains, use baking soda and water to clean the inside. Hand wash only.
  • Always air dry the cooler with the lid open before storing. This reduces the risk of mold and mildew growth.
Storage
  • It is recommended that you leave the zipper in the closed position with the slider pulled fully, which will help protect the waterproof seal and the zipper closure.
  • Remove odors with a tea bag or activated carbon bag in the cooler.
  • Apply the lubricant (silicone grease) to the inside and outside of the zipper regularly, which can extend the service life of the zipper.
